Cannon shell found in local garage

060706_cannon.jpgWe've all found some unexpected things when we're moving, right? That's what happened to a family in Nassau Bay yesterday, except what they found was a cannon shell. A moving crew found the ammo in the garage of a home on Bal Harbour Drive near NASA Parkway and ordered nearby residents to evacute.

It turns out the shell wasn't live — the previous owner of the house was a war veteran, so neighbors figured he kept the shell for some reason and accidentally left behind. Once the threat was over, neighbors were allowed to return to their houses.
